Transaction 7343ceeb4afffd9198d6853720c42381d509dea89447261756f35692d5e0be03
1 Input
1 Outputs
- 7343ceeb4afffd9198d6853720c42381d509dea89447261756f35692d5e0be03:0
value 5000000000
address 03086610c06e6b25288ea29a0266dc2f1942b296c9e1149f092a770b63c9e4ae6f